Destiny 2 Server Status
Destiny 2, like many online games, requires a stable connection to its servers for optimal gameplay. Server issues can arise from time to time, affecting your ability to log in or maintain a connection. Regularly checking the server status can help you determine if the issues you’re facing are on your end or if they are widespread. Websites like Bungie’s official Twitter account or community forums are excellent resources for real-time updates.
Destiny 2 PS4 Servers Status: Scheduled Maintenance
Bungie schedules regular maintenance to ensure the game runs smoothly and efficiently. During these times, Destiny 2 servers may be temporarily taken offline. Maintenance schedules are usually announced in advance, allowing players to plan their gaming sessions accordingly. Typically, these updates are aimed at improving server stability, fixing bugs, and occasionally, rolling out new content.
Understanding Outages

While scheduled maintenance is predictable, unscheduled outages can occur unexpectedly due to a variety of reasons, including server overloads, technical glitches, or external factors like power outages. When an outage occurs, it’s essential to stay informed through Bungie’s official channels to understand the cause and estimated downtime.
